Abstract

YEPEZ, Ricardo; MALAGON, Clara  and  OLMOS, Carlos. Pediatric sarcoidosis: a report of seven cases. Rev.Colomb.Reumatol. [online]. 2013, vol.20, n.2, pp.102-110. ISSN 0121-8123.

Sarcoidosis is a chronic granulomatous disease of non-infectious origin which can involve various target organs. Its prevalence is low and there have been only isolated cases reported in Colombia. Its etiology and pathophysiology are not well known. The clinical presentation and signs of the disease vary. When its onset is before five years of age it is recognized as early onset sarcoidosis, while if its onset is after five years of age it is called late onset sarcoidosis. In this case report all patients had a delayed diagnosis and they presented with a multiple organ involvement which required an immunosuppressive treatment. Of the 7 patients, 4 had a chronic course, 2 had remission, and 1 with frequent relapses of the disease. There was an unusual relationship of two patients with early onset disease who additionally presented with Ollier's disease.
